Flirt4Free does not show you what a credit costs until you have bought some.
The only packs on its Buy Credits page in September 2026 were first-purchase
offers at $20, $40 and $80, each with free credits added. What a second purchase
costs is the number this page does not have.
The site has been running since 1996, which makes it older than most of the people on it, and it has spent that time building the most produced private-show experience in this directory. It is also among the more expensive places to have one, and both facts come from the same decision.
Thirty to sixty credits a minute
A private runs 30 to 60 credits a minute,
Flirt4Free’s own published range rather than anything I measured. What that is in dollars needs a price per
credit this site does not hold. The one on record is the first-purchase pack, 240
credits for $20, and the page does not make clear whether the 240 includes the
free credits. A first purchase is not what an evening costs, so there is no
dollar figure for a minute on this page.
This page used to put one here, off a six-tier ladder from $10 to $500 and a $10 entry tier 25% worse per credit than its top. That ladder came from a registry, the Buy Credits page matched it on no pack at all, and it is on corrections. There is no rung to optimise until the standing ladder is read.
Card, PayPal, gift card or crypto, and the statement reads VS3.com or SegPay.
Built for the private, not for the public room
The privates are the product and it shows. Rooms are better lit and better shot than the token-site average, the VIP and multi-tier structure gives performers something to build a show around, and the platform has a stable vetted roster rather than an open-door one.
The trade is the public layer. Free chat here is thinner than on the big token sites. It exists, but it is a preview rather than an evening, and the culture is not tip-to-watch. If your habit is sitting in a busy public room, this will feel sparse and slightly formal.
There is a real amount of interface on the screen: features, buttons, panels. Some of it rewards learning and some of it is there because 1996.
